Given the local agricultural environment and summer heat, common issues for Chevrolets in Terra Bella include air conditioning system failures, cooling system problems (like thermostat or radiator issues), and increased wear on suspension components from rural road conditions. Trucks like the Silverado may also see more frequent brake and transmission service due to hauling or towing.

You should seek immediate service if your Chevrolet's temperature gauge moves into the red, especially during our hot summers, to prevent engine damage. Also, address any check engine lights promptly, as issues like faulty oxygen sensors can affect fuel efficiency, which is important for longer commutes on Highway 190 or rural roads.
Yes, the dust and particulate matter from local farming operations can clog air filters and cabin filters more quickly, requiring more frequent changes. Additionally, the mix of highway and rough rural roads means tire rotations, alignments, and shock/strut inspections should be performed regularly to ensure safe handling and even tire wear.
